Waptichasr and I went out this morning, by 7:38 we both had deer. I got a doe, and Bob got a buck. Ill let him tell his story. I shot my doe from a tree stand at 15 yds. using my saxon arc angel recurve, 50lbs at 28. A cedar shafted arrow tipped with a zwickey 2 blade broad head.
This is my first trad deer ever.

i went to a little "secret" spot this morning near hoosic. its a small patch of woods that deer have to funnel through to get to their bedding area. i saw 2 does in there yesterday, and i found the trail that it looks like every deer uses to go through. there is no suitable trees for my climber so i made a ground blind and brought the longbow out for its first deer hunt. i setup for a 15 yd shot, so i said this is perfect.
i saw 2 does at 7:30. (same time that they came through yesterday) the does kept lookin behind them but veered off the run and moved past at 25 yds.
at 8:11 i looked to my left and saw a white muzzle lookin at me from 30 yds!! and then i saw the rack!!  :eek:   i dont care much about horns, im more of a meat hunter. but this deer had to be 140 to 150 class!! it just surveyed the area, and turned to his right and slowly walked into the thicket. he obviously didnt like what he saw.
i was so rattled by seeing a buck like that i was useless for about 2 hours!!! i dont think i would have been able to shoot a 60 lb doe i was shakin so bad!!!

anyway, it was my first day ever hunting with trad gear, and i had quite an experience. to bad i couldnt have talked myself into doing it sooner.  :banghead:  
i saw another buck chasing a doe in a field on my way home at 11 oclock. so get out there and sit as long as ya can, cause it on......
